**FAQ: How do I get into the hardware lab overnight?**

Night-shift staff at Quillhaven Labs may enter the hardware lab on Level B1 between 22:00 and 06:00, provided the entry is logged in the overnight register kept by the loading-bay desk. Check that the extraction fans are running before touching any soldering stations, and never leave the outer door on the latch — it must fully close behind you. The reader accepts the current rotating door-pass, listed below.

door code, yagap-bahof: bdg-O-05

Minutes — Management Meeting

Prepared for the incoming director. Topic: possible acquisition of Greyfen Analytics. Due diligence 70% complete. Valuation gap remains; Greyfen seeks a premium. Integration risks flagged by Ops. Decision deferred to next month. Talla Nyberg leads negotiations. Our walk-away position is stated below.

board note of fawig-kagup: Only 48 of the 435 pilot accounts renewed Rusion, so a churn review is set for September 12. Fenwynox Logistics is in early talks to buy Sorielek Systems for about $117.8 million.

**Ticket VERT-1182 — Dispatch queue accepts unsanitized floor requests**

The Vertigo elevator-dispatch simulator allows floor request payloads to bypass bounds validation when submitted through the replay harness, letting simulated cars target nonexistent floors and corrupt the scheduler state. No production exposure, but the reviewer should confirm the replay path is gated before sign-off. Reproduced consistently on the staging cluster. The affected build's trace token is listed below for reference.

pipeline stamp: htk9_fa6ea24b2